Caramelized Ripe Plantains
- Level: Easy
- Yield: 6 to 8 servings

Ingredients
4 ripe plantains
1 tablespoon butter
1 tablespoon sugar
Vanilla ice cream, for serving
Directions
- Peel the plantains and slice them into 1/2-inch rounds. Heat the butter to foaming in a heavy skillet over medium heat. Add the plantain slices to the butter and cook for 5 to 8 minutes, or until they are lightly browned and slightly caramelized. Sprinkle the plantain slices with the sugar, allow the sugar to caramelize slightly, then remove the plantains from the skillet. Serve warm.
- These plantain slices are also particularly good when served over vanilla ice cream, topped with the caramelized butter from the pan.
